I purchased this quilt years ago at an estate sale for $4. It was quite thick, but appeared unused.

I decided to take it apart and hand quilt it.

Just look at those stitches!

I ended up removing the borders and making new ones out of the backing fabric because they were a bit of a hot mess as you can see.

It’s now basted and I hope to start hand quilting today.
